Tournament gifts given to contestants are most times not only unique, but hard to find. The rarity makes them very sought-after by collectors, especially if they come from a tournament with exceptional status like the Memorial Tournament. In 1984, Jack Nicklaus won his tournament at Muirfield Village Golf Club, in the process becoming the first two-time champion. Offered here is the Memorial Tournament Gift from that year - a 5” diameter Coin Dish originally belonging to Peter Oosterhuis.
